LEGO Star Wars The Force Awakens E3 trailer. Demo drops on Xbox One and PS4

Not sure if you had realised but E3 is here. Warner Bros certainly have as they’ve dropped a new trailer for LEGO Star Wars: The Force Awakens. Oh, and they decided it’s probably for the best to drop a demo of the game onto our consoles.

Whilst you can check out the E3 trailer in all its glory up above, the big news for us is that a demo for The Force Awakens is arriving on Xbox One from June 14th (around 3pm PDT). Playstation owners who wish to check it out on their PS4’s can do so from today!

The free downloadable demo for LEGO Star Wars: The Force Awakens comes in the form of The Niima Outpost. It will allow fans and newcomers to join Rey, Finn and BB-8 as they evade the First Order in their daring escape from Jakku. As part of this exciting content, players can experience new features coming to LEGO Star Wars: The Force Awakens, including taking on Stormtroopers in intense Blaster Battles, utilising Multi-Builds to explore the wreckage of Imperial Star Destroyers and piloting the Millennium Falcon in dogfights against First Order Tie fighters.

LEGO Star Wars: The Force Awakens will release on June 28th 2016 on Xbox One, Xbox 360, PS3, PS4, PS Vita, Wii U, 3DS and PC.
